Pay among women general counsel outpaced men in 2022 for only the second time since 2018, according to the latest compensation benchmarking report from corporate leadership data provider Equilar.
The survey, “General Counsel Pay Trends,” analyzed compensation reported to the Securities and Exchange Commission for 179 of the 500 largest companies by revenue that trade on one of the three major U.S. stock exchanges for the fiscal year ending March 1, 2022, to Feb. 28, 2023.
